From the oldest Pinot Noir vines on the estate hence Block 1. Just 3 puncheons produced - the best barrels in 2022 that really stood out and which deserved their own designation and label. The wine is 1/3 whole bunch (which comes from the 777). The balance is destemmed 114/115. Matured in French oak puncheons. Three puncheons in total with one being a new puncheon. The other two puncheons came from 5 year old oak. The wine spent approximately 20 days on skins before pressing. It spent a total of 11 months in oak. Wild fermentation.
Alcohol: 13.3%, TA : 6.3, PH: 3.60 Notably deeper richer and spicier than the estate cuvee and will age comfortably for years to come yet very impressive already...
